Output e34c8160c468ff80e67a0958c0c02ccb5ab58c06fafa0030ae253299376e5f8d:0

value
173500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3dcd5278993b58e2164e59d3034e3b16eb54e1 OP_EQUAL
address
37N7rX1beVH388mzCtpvf6JUusw7WdSwFU
transaction
e34c8160c468ff80e67a0958c0c02ccb5ab58c06fafa0030ae253299376e5f8d
spent
true